Many homeowners opt for asphalt shingles with a cool-roof rating. These are designed to reflect more solar radiant heat. This can help keep your attic cooler and reduce your energy bills. Ask the pros about specific brands and styles that perform well in our climate.

Polycarbonate roof panels can be a viable option for certain applications in Las Vegas, especially for patios or sunrooms. They offer good impact resistance and allow light to pass through. However, for a primary residential roof, they might not offer the same level of insulation or durability as traditional roofing materials. Discuss your specific needs with a roofing professional to see if they're the right fit.
Rolled roofing is a type of asphalt-based roofing material that comes in large rolls. It's often used for low-slope or flat roofs, like on garages or additions. While it can be a more budget-friendly option, its lifespan might be shorter compared to other materials in the intense Las Vegas sun. In Las Vegas, residential roofing issues often stem from intense sun exposure and occasional strong winds. Common problems include cracked or curling shingles, granule loss, and damage to flashing around vents or chimneys. Proper ventilation is also key to prevent heat buildup. Regular inspections can help catch these issues before they lead to more serious damage.
